Mediate "Rocs" PTI

Rocco Mediate was on Pardon the Interruption this afternoon to talk about the U.S. Open playoff against Tiger Woods Monday, which Woods won in dramatic fashion. I've got to say Mediate is one of the best sports interviews I've seen in a long time. He praised Tiger's gutty play and epic finish and even though he was obviously outclassed in the tourney, he didn't come off as a startstruck nobody who was just happy to be on the same course as a superstar. Not only was he well-spoken and funny, but he seemed genuinely happy to have played 91 holes of competitive golf despite the loss.

Not to say I don't like Tiger--how can you not?--but count me among Roc's fans after his classy performance during and after the Open.
